1 DATE: OCTOBER 20, 2013 SERMON TEXT: PSALM 121 SERMON TITLE: "Rivers, Deserts and Mountaintops" There is something to be said about geography and spirituality. There is a connection between the lay of the land and the condition of one s soul. And it has been that way since the beginning of time. Sharon and I vacationed in the mountains and lakes of Vermont and New York this summer. We traveled through hundreds of miles of some of the most beautiful country in the United States. The roadways follow the streams and rivers that make their way along the base of the mountains, and around every turn there waits a spectacular view. I don t know if I get homesick for the farm or if it is simply part of my DNA, but the pastoral scenery of our northeastern countryside feeds my spirit. I think that is why we journey to such places. I think that s why we head to the shore or the mountains and not to South Philly. There is something about immersing ourselves in the splendor of God s creative beauty that literally feeds our souls. And it seems that ever since we came into being we have found a connectedness between soul and soil, spirit and water, life and land. The Bible is full of these images. The writers of our Biblical text used time and time again the lay of the land to tell the story of a people and their relationship with God. And it seems that the three geographical images that appear most often are rivers, deserts, and mountaintops.

2 Rivers have always been an important allegory in Bible stories. Almost always rivers symbolize transitions in one s life, both literally and spiritually. Take for instance one of the most significant Bible stories, the account of the Exodus from Egypt of the Hebrews. One of the most dramatic points in the journey came with the crossing of the Red Sea. It was dramatic in one sense of the word because of the way it happened its theatrical portrayal, the physical-ness of the act. God literally opened the waters for his people and they walked across the bed of the sea on what we are told was dry land. The climax of their forty-year journey in the desert was a crossing of another body of water, the River Jordan, the symbol of the promise of God, the boundary to the promised land of God, another transition in the lives of those who chose to follow. Throughout the Bible there are a multitude of river images with this recurring theme of transition. John the Baptist is introduced in the New Testament as the voice crying out in the wilderness, beckoning people to come to a transition in their lives, leaving a life of sin and choosing a new life committed to God. Jesus, in his preaching and teaching, is constantly crossing the Sea of Galilee and the River Jordan as he encourages people to consider a new way of living their lives, a new way of understanding their relationship with God. As an ever-present part of our geographical landscape, rivers serve as a symbol 2

3 of the transition and transformation in our spiritual lives. Another geographical image that is not quite as positive as a river is the desert. The desert, as we all know, is a place where there is not much life. It is hot and dry and barren. In scripture, deserts usually lie near or between rivers and mountains. Consider again the Exodus account. As soon as the Hebrew people crossed the Red Sea, they entered into the desert. Deserts for the Hebrews and for most people who enter there are places of the unknown, of searching, of struggle, of trying to find oneself. Sometimes the word "wilderness is used interchangeably with desert. The word wilderness certainly adds nuance to the concept of being lost and alone in a world of the unknown. However, the desert should not always be viewed as a hostile place, particularly in terms of a place to live. The Hebrew people survived in the desert for 40 years. The desert is usually a place where one is called to struggle with one s own being, to do extensive soul searching, and in many cases to come face to face with God. Consider the account of Jesus and the forty days he spent in his desert. It was here that he came face to face with his own internal struggle. He was called to follow God, yet he was tempted by Satan to rule the world. It was for him a time to come to grips with the ultimate reality of what he was called to this earth to do. He endured 3

4 his temptation and was then transformed in the water of the River Jordan. And then there is the mountaintop. Geographically speaking, the mountaintop takes us to a different plane, a higher altitude, a different visual perspective. The same is also true spiritually. Biblically, mountaintops are where we experience God. It was on the mountain that Moses encountered God. It was on the mountain that we received the very essence of our faith, the Ten Commandments. It was on the mountain that Jesus was transfigured before three of his disciples and they saw him in the fullness of his divinity. And it was on the mountain that Jesus died.
